<p><b>laura@ucar.edu</b> 2011-02-09 09:58:18 -0700 (Wed, 09 Feb 2011)</p><p>added statements for initialization of Thompson cloud microphysics<br>
</p><hr noshade><pre><font color="gray">Modified: branches/atmos_physics/src/core_physics/physics_wrf/module_mp_thompson.F
===================================================================
--- branches/atmos_physics/src/core_physics/physics_wrf/module_mp_thompson.F        2011-02-09 16:54:00 UTC (rev 730)
+++ branches/atmos_physics/src/core_physics/physics_wrf/module_mp_thompson.F        2011-02-09 16:58:18 UTC (rev 731)
@@ -728,6 +728,26 @@
read(11) tnr_racg
read(11) tnr_gacr
close(unit=11)
+ write(0,*) ' end read table_qr_acr_qg.dat'
+ write(0,*)
+ write(0,*) '--- end subroutine qr_acr_qg:'
+ write(0,*) 'max tcg_racg =',maxval(tcg_racg)
+ write(0,*) 'min tcg_racg =',minval(tcg_racg)
+
+ write(0,*) 'max tmr_racg =',maxval(tmr_racg)
+ write(0,*) 'min tmr_racg =',minval(tmr_racg)
+
+ write(0,*) 'max tcr_gacr =',maxval(tcr_gacr)
+ write(0,*) 'min tcr_gacr =',minval(tcr_gacr)
+
+ write(0,*) 'max tmg_gacr =',maxval(tmg_gacr)
+ write(0,*) 'min tmg_gacr =',minval(tmg_gacr)
+
+ write(0,*) 'max tnr_racg =',maxval(tnr_racg)
+ write(0,*) 'min tnr_racg =',minval(tnr_racg)
+
+ write(0,*) 'max tnr_gacr =',maxval(tnr_gacr)
+ write(0,*) 'min tnr_gacr =',minval(tnr_gacr)
! DO ig1 = 1, ntb_g1
! DO ig = 1, ntb_g
! DO ir1 = 1, ntb_r1
@@ -776,7 +796,38 @@
read(11) tnr_sacr2
close(unit=11)
write(0,*) ' end read table_qr_acr_qs.dat'
+ write(0,*)
+ write(0,*) '--- end subroutine qr_acr_qs:'
+ write(0,*) 'max tcs_racs1 =',maxval(tcs_racs1)
+ write(0,*) 'min tcs_racs1 =',minval(tcs_racs1)
+ write(0,*) 'max tmr_racs1 =',maxval(tmr_racs1)
+ write(0,*) 'min tmr_racs1 =',minval(tmr_racs1)
+
+ write(0,*) 'max tcr_sacr1 =',maxval(tcr_sacr1)
+ write(0,*) 'min tcr_sacr1 =',minval(tcr_sacr1)
+
+ write(0,*) 'max tms_sacr1 =',maxval(tms_sacr1)
+ write(0,*) 'min tms_sacr1 =',minval(tms_sacr1)
+
+ write(0,*) 'max tcr_sacr2 =',maxval(tcr_sacr2)
+ write(0,*) 'min tcr_sacr2 =',minval(tcr_sacr2)
+
+ write(0,*) 'max tcr_sacr2 =',maxval(tcr_sacr2)
+ write(0,*) 'min tcr_sacr2 =',minval(tcr_sacr2)
+
+ write(0,*) 'max tnr_racs1 =',maxval(tnr_racs1)
+ write(0,*) 'min tnr_racs1 =',minval(tnr_racs1)
+
+ write(0,*) 'max tnr_racs2 =',maxval(tnr_racs2)
+ write(0,*) 'min tnr_racs2 =',minval(tnr_racs2)
+
+ write(0,*) 'max tnr_sacr1 =',maxval(tnr_sacr1)
+ write(0,*) 'min tnr_sacr1 =',minval(tnr_sacr1)
+
+ write(0,*) 'max tnr_sacr2 =',maxval(tnr_sacr2)
+ write(0,*) 'min tnr_sacr2 =',minval(tnr_sacr2)
+
!..Cloud water and rain freezing (Bigg, 1953).
open(unit=11,file='./LOOKUP_TABLES/table_freezeH2O.dat', &
form='unformatted',status='old',action='read')
@@ -788,7 +839,26 @@
read(11) tni_qcfz
close(unit=11)
write(0,*) ' end read table_freezeH2O.dat'
+ write(0,*)
+ write(0,*) '--- end subroutine freezeH2O:'
+ write(0,*) 'max tpi_qrfz =',maxval(tpi_qrfz)
+ write(0,*) 'min tpi_qrfz =',minval(tpi_qrfz)
+ write(0,*) 'max tni_qrfz =',maxval(tni_qrfz)
+ write(0,*) 'min tni_qrfz =',minval(tni_qrfz)
+
+ write(0,*) 'max tpg_qrfz =',maxval(tpg_qrfz)
+ write(0,*) 'min tpg_qrfz =',minval(tpg_qrfz)
+
+ write(0,*) 'max tnr_qrfz =',maxval(tnr_qrfz)
+ write(0,*) 'min tnr_qrfz =',minval(tnr_qrfz)
+
+ write(0,*) 'max tpi_qcfz =',maxval(tpi_qcfz)
+ write(0,*) 'min tpi_qcfz =',minval(tpi_qcfz)
+
+ write(0,*) 'max tni_qcfz =',maxval(tni_qcfz)
+ write(0,*) 'min tni_qcfz =',minval(tni_qcfz)
+
!..Conversion of some ice mass into snow category.
open(unit=11,file='./LOOKUP_TABLES/table_qi_aut_qs.dat', &
form='unformatted',status='old',action='read')
@@ -797,6 +867,12 @@
read(11) tni_iaus
close(unit=11)
write(0,*) ' end read table_qi_aut_qs.dat'
+ write(0,*) '--- end subroutine qi_aut_qs:'
+ write(0,*) 'max tps_iaus =',maxval(tps_iaus)
+ write(0,*) 'min tps_iaus =',minval(tps_iaus)
+
+ write(0,*) 'max tni_iaus =',maxval(tni_iaus)
+ write(0,*) 'min tni_iaus =',minval(tni_iaus)
write(0,*) ' end pre-calculated look-up tables'
iiwarm = .false.
</font>
</pre>